If you really want to go exploring, go to Mission Santa Maria, outside of Catavenia. Be prepared, be very prepared for a very, very bad 12 or so mile road. Reward will be a oasis of ponds, palm trees and the old mission that is quietly melting back into the ground. Punta Canoas can provide some excellent surf, but it will take you some time to get there. The seven sisters can be very wild, hit it good, it will be epic. Hit it bad, bring beer. Good luck, have fun.
